Posted Breed: Boxer / Mixed. Diesel will be the first to tell you what a good boy he is. Such a good boy that he can have that hambuger you're holding, right? Well, okay. a treat will do. He's such a

View more

sweet, goofy boy that he deserves many treats. Diesel loves all other creatures - dogs, grownup humans and their kids, and cats, too. He gets a kick out of running, playing chase and wrestling with his dog buddies. And he's very interested in his cat housemates; he wants to play with them and sometimes can't understand why they ignore him. A very affectionate boy, he loves getting attention from his people and returns it with many kisses. Lounging on the couch and snuggling with them to watch TV is a favorite pasttime, as is going for walks, and he's making good progress on his leash training. He's an easygoing boy who matches his person's pace. If you want to run, he'll run; if you'd rather walk, that's fine with him. Indoors, he's happy to curl up with a rawhide or take a nap, but he'll never pass up a chance to play with another dog. He's so excited to see new people and dogs that his whole rear end wags. Diesel is crate and house trained, and answers to the Sit, Stay and Go-Get-In-Your-Bed commands. This sociable boy would love a home with at least one companion who is home most of the time, and one with a yard to roam and dogs and older kids to play with would be ideal. If that sounds like yours, come meet Diesel.

  1. Do your research - find out what types of dogs would be a good fit for your lifestyle and the activity level of your family. Also keep in mind the grooming needs of certain breeds that might require frequent maintenance.
  2. Decide what you can handle - before you get sucked in by all the adorable puppy eyes you're about to see, think long and hard about the appropriate age dog for your family or if you are capable of caring for a special needs dog. Puppies are a lot of work, if you don't have time for potty training and obedience classes you'll want to consider an older dog. There are plenty of middle aged, vibrant dogs up for adoption as well as many senior dogs that would be a great fit for a family looking for a more subdued dog with lots of love to give.
  3. Learn about the shelters and their adoption policies - It might be easier to start looking at shelters within a certain radius of home but don't be afraid to venture out to other states as well. Many states have larger populations of adoptable dogs and their shelters are willing to transport pets to suitable adopting families. Some shelters might have requirements for a home visit, a fenced yard or require you to visit the pet multiple times before you commit to adopting. Understand that the shelters are doing their best to place the pets in suitable homes and these requirements are in the best interest of both you and the pet
  4. Start looking… - Once you know what you're looking for and what to expect you can start your search through thousands of adoptable dogs. PuppyFinder allows you to search by age, breed, location and gender.
  5. Meet in person. - Whenever possible it is best to meet the animal in person before agreeing to bring them into your life. Even though photos and descriptions can tell you a bit about a dog, you can't get a true feeling for the animal until you are able to interact with them and make sure they are a good fit for your entire family, including other pets.
